An enthusiastic review and recommendation for the tour-guide services of Augusnel Charlot, from a USA traveler who visited Cap-Haitien and nearby areas in early 2026. Augusnel has guided visitors for more than a decade, focusing on the cultural and natural richness and beauty of north Haiti, though he can also show you around other parts of the nation (for example, Jacmel, Jeremie, and Les Cayes). I contacted Augusnel well in advance of my four-day trip. We worked out an agenda that included airport pick-up and drop-off, a walking tour of in-town Cap-Haitien sites and its colorful architecture, Labadee village, the awesome and world-famous Citadelle Laferriere (getting up there is half the fun!) and Sans Souci palace, and a full day of turquoise-water boating (with a lunch of freshly caught, deliciously cooked seafood) to idyllic tropical Amiga Island and Cadras Beach. He can offer suggestions and tailor-make an itinerary that suits your exact travel desires. People around the area know Augusnel, and he also engages trusted assistants for boat captaining, meal preparation, etc., as needed. Whether you’re a solo traveler, in a small group, in a large group, on vacation, or on business, Augusnel is the one to welcome you to Haiti. (To note, U.S. dollars are accepted everywhere for everything and can easily be exchanged for gourde too. Be sure to get some pretty souvenirs at the Cap-Haitien Marche Artisanal and on the way to/from the Citadelle.) Augusnel speaks fluent Creole, French, and English, and knows some Spanish too. He thoroughly understands the nation’s history and local lore, so your visit will be enriched with not just the sights and sounds of Haiti, but also the meaning of what you’re experiencing. You’ll enjoy the general warmth, friendliness, and good cheer of the many local people you encounter along the way.
